Made by famous New York rod maker Walt Carpenter, this 2/2 rod is in good condition and features Walt's darkly flamed cane, blued ferrules, deep brown wraps with black tipping, and a cap & ring reel seat with burled black walnut spacer. Carpenter's signature is neatly inked on the butt section and he added a nice spiral signature wrap above his name. The handle is a modified Well's style with an expanded front ring which acts as a comfortable thumb rest. Although the varnish is solid, some areas have a dull sheen and may have been polished, and the wraps and ferrules on both tips have been over-coated with varnish. The ferrules are tight, and all sections are straight and full length. This rod has a crisp dry fly action and comes with the original bag and labeled tube.
